Chanterelle Risotto is a luxurious Italian rice dish featuring creamy Arborio or Carnaroli rice slowly cooked with golden chanterelle mushrooms, aromatic vegetables, white wine, and rich broth. The dish hails from Northern Italy, where risotto is a culinary staple and foraged mushrooms like chanterelles are highly prized seasonal treasures.

🍽️ Nutrition at a glance

This dish is moderately high in carbohydrates from the rice and contains a good amount of fat from butter and cheese, with a moderate protein content. It provides key nutrients like B vitamins, selenium, and potassium from the mushrooms, with a typical serving ranging from 400-500 calories.

💡 What's interesting

Culturally, risotto represents the Italian art of patience and technique, as the slow stirring releases starches to create its signature creamy texture without cream. Nutritionally, chanterelles are a wild-foraged superfood rich in vitamin D and antioxidants, making this comfort food surprisingly nutrient-dense.
